Professional Software Analyst Cover Letter Examples for 2024

Home > 
Professional Software Analyst Cover...

Your software analyst cover letter must highlight your analytical skills. Demonstrate your capability to dissect complex software systems and pinpoint areas for improvement. Elucidate your proficiency in communicating technical solutions to non-technical stakeholders. It's essential to show that you can bridge the gap between software development and business requirements.

Crafting a software analyst cover letter can be daunting, especially when you've begun your job search and realize it's a vital piece of the application puzzle. You might know it's not a resume repeat; it's your chance to weave a narrative around your proudest professional milestone. Striking the balance between formal tone and fresh prose, steering clear of tired clichés, and keeping it to one compelling page adds to the challenge. Let's dig into making your cover letter stand out.

Your software analyst cover letter has and will never look better - let us guide you on:

  • Making excellent use of job-winning real-life professional cover letters;
  • Writing the first paragraphs of your software analyst cover letter to get attention and connect with the recruiters - immediately;
  • Single out your most noteworthy achievement (even if it's outside your career);
  • Get a better understanding of what you must include in your software analyst cover letter to land the job.

Let the power of Enhancv's AI work for you: create your software analyst cover letter by uploading your resume.

Software Analyst cover letter example

Owen Wright

Dallas, Texas


Dear Hiring Manager,

I am writing to express my interest in the software development position at your esteemed company, where my extensive experience with RPG, Ignition, and data systems, combined with a track record of impactful leadership, can contribute significantly to your team's success.

During my tenure at GlobalTech Solutions for over three years, I architected and led the development of mission-critical automation software that enhanced industrial equipment efficiency by 15%. This initiative, involving a rigorous process of design, implementation, and testing, not only boosted system performance but also played a vital role in achieving a sustainable technology roadmap for the company. The collaborative effort of integrating SCADA systems into existing infrastructure is a testament to my ability to lead effectively and deliver solutions that directly influence corporate operations.

I am eager to bring my proven expertise in software optimization, strategic planning, and system integration to a new and challenging environment. Let's discuss how my background, skills, and achievements will align with the goals of your organization. I am looking forward to the opportunity to further explain how I can contribute to the team.


Owen Wright

Senior Software Developer
What makes this cover letter good:

  • Relevant Experience: The cover letter effectively showcases the candidate's expertise with specific systems (e.g., RPG, Ignition) that are likely pertinent to the job, demonstrating an immediate value-add to the company's tech stack.
  • Impactful Leadership: By mentioning his leadership in the development of automation software that achieved a significant efficiency boost, the candidate positions himself as not just a developer, but a strategic leader with a history of delivering results.
  • Highlighting Achievements: Specific quantifiable achievements, such as improving equipment efficiency by 15%, are highlighted, providing concrete evidence of the candidate's ability to contribute meaningfully to the organization's success.
  • System Integration Skills: The candidate notes their experience in integrating SCADA systems, a skill that could be particularly important for roles involving complex system architecture or industrial automation contexts.

What are the basics of the design or format of your software analyst cover letter?

To start, here's a reminder for you: the Applicant Tracker System (or software that is used to assess candidate profiles), won't be reading your software analyst cover letter.

Recruiters enjoy reading software analyst cover letters with a standardized format that uses:

  • the same font as the resume (e.g. modern ones like Raleway or Volkhov are prefered over the clichéd Times New Roman or Arial);
  • single spacing to keep the content concise and organized (this is all ready for you in our cover letter templates);
  • a one-inch margin to wrap around the text, like in our cover letter builder;
  • PDF as a file format, as it allows your design (and visual element) to stay the same.

Finally, we can't go on without mentioning the key sections of your software analyst cover letter.

In the top one-third, make sure to include a header (with your contact information, name, role, and date), a salutation, and an introduction.

Next, follows the heart and soul of your software analyst cover letter or its body.

End your software analyst cover letter with a closing paragraph and, if you wish, a signature.

top sections icon

The top sections on a software analyst cover letter

  • Header (Including Contact Information): Essential for providing your name, address, phone number, and email to ensure the recruiter can easily reach you for further discussion or to schedule an interview.
  • Greeting (Tailored Address): Demonstrates your professionalism and attention to detail by using the hiring manager's name when available, making your application feel more personal and showing genuine interest in the role.
  • Introduction (Objective and Enthusiasm): Serves to capture the recruiter's attention by clearly stating your intent to apply for the software analyst position, and expressing genuine excitement about the opportunity to contribute to the company.
  • Body (Relevant Experience and Skills): This is where you outline your previous work experiences, specific software analysis skills, and problem-solving capabilities that align with the needs of the prospective job, proving your suitability for the role.
  • Closing (Call to Action): Concludes the cover letter with a proactive statement suggesting the next step, such as anticipating an interview, which shows your eagerness to move forward in the application process.
top sections icon

Key qualities recruiters search for in a candidate’s cover letter

  • Proficiency in software engineering and system development: This demonstrates a thorough understanding of the software lifecycle and the ability to analyze and improve complex systems.
  • Analytical and problem-solving skills: Recruiters value analysts who can dissect software-related issues and devise effective solutions.
  • Experience with software quality assurance: A background in testing and ensuring that software meets the required standards is crucial for mitigating risks and assuring quality.
  • Familiarity with programming languages and databases: This shows that the candidate can effectively communicate with developers and understand the technical nuances of software projects.
  • Knowledge of the latest industry trends and technologies: Being up-to-date with the current software developments indicates a candidate's commitment to continuous learning and adaptability to change.
  • Strong communication and documentation skills: These are essential for effectively conveying analysis findings, producing clear documentation, and collaborating with cross-functional teams.

Personalizing your software analyst cover letter salutation

Always aim to address the recruiter from the get-go of your software analyst cover letter.


  • the friendly tone (e.g. "Dear Paul" or "Dear Caroline") - if you've previously chatted up with them on social media and are on a first-name basis;
  • the formal tone (e.g. "Dear Ms. Gibbs" or "Dear Ms. Swift") - if you haven't had any previous conversation with them and have discovered the name of the recruiter on LinkedIn or the company website;
  • the polite tone (e.g. "Dear Hiring Manager" or "Dear HR Team") - at all costs aim to avoid the "To whom it may concern" or "Dear Sir/Madam", as both greetings are very old-school and vague.
top sections icon

List of salutations you can use

  • Dear Hiring Manager,
  • Dear [Company Name] Team,
  • Dear [Department Name] Hiring Committee,
  • Dear Ms. [Last Name],
  • Dear Mr. [Last Name],
  • Dear Dr. [Last Name],

Introducing your profile to catch recruiters' attention in no more than two sentences

The introduction of your software analyst cover letter is a whole Catch 22 .

You have an allocated space of no more than just a paragraph (of up to two sentences). With your introduction, you have to stand out and show why you're the best candidate out there.

Set out on a journey with your software analyst cover letter by focusing on why you're passionate about the job. Match your personal skills and interests to the role.

Another option for your software analyst cover letter introduction is to show you're the ideal candidate. Write about how your achievements and skills are precisely what the company is looking for.

However you decide to start your software analyst cover letter, always remember to write about the value you'd bring about. Making it both tangible (with your metrics of success) and highly sought out.

Intro Paragraph
Immersed in the latest trends of software analysis and fueled by a keen appreciation for [Company's] commitment to cutting-edge solutions, I offer a proven track record of delivering actionable insights for technology enhancements. Having meticulously followed your revolutionary approaches within [Industry/Specific Project], I am eager to contribute to and grow with your esteemed team.

What to write in the body of your software analyst cover letter

Now that you've got your intro covered, here comes the heart and soul of your software analyst cover letter.

It's time to write the middle or body paragraphs. This is the space where you talk about your relevant talent in terms of hard skills (or technologies) and soft (or people and communication) skills.

Keep in mind that the cover letter has a different purpose from your software analyst resume.

Yes, you still have to be able to show recruiters what makes your experience unique (and applicable) to the role.

But, instead of just listing skills, aim to tell a story of your one, greatest accomplishment.

Select your achievement that:

  • covers job-crucial skills;
  • can be measured with tangible metrics;
  • shows you in the best light.

Use the next three to six paragraphs to detail what this success has taught you, and also to sell your profile.

Body Paragraph
At my previous role, I spearheaded the optimization of a major client's software system, which enhanced system efficiency by 40% and reduced error rates by 30%. My analytical approach and performance tuning skills led to a direct increase in client satisfaction by 25%, showcasing my ability to translate technical improvements into tangible business benefits.

Two ideas on how to end the final paragraph of your software analyst cover letter

Closing your software analyst cover letter, you want to leave a memorable impression on recruiters, that you're a responsible professional.

End your cover letter with how you envision your growth, as part of the company. Make realistic promises on what you plan to achieve, potentially, in the next six months to a year.

Before your signature, you could also signal hiring managers that you're available for the next steps. Or, a follow-up call, during which you could further clarify your experience or professional value.

Closing Paragraph
I welcome the opportunity to discuss how my skills align with the needs of your team. Please feel free to schedule an interview at your earliest convenience.

Lacking experience: here's how to write your software analyst cover letter

As a candidate with no experience, it's important to be honest from the get-go of your application.

Use your software analyst cover letter to sell your unique talents. Choose an accomplishment from your academic background or your volunteer work to show the skills that are relevant to the role.

Focus on your career objectives and how you see the job to align with them. Be specific and, at the same time, realistic about where you picture yourself in five years.

Key takeaways

Writing your software analyst cover letter has never been easier, so remember to:

  • Select a software analyst cover letter template that automatically meets industry formatting (e.g. has one-inch margins, is single-spaced, is in PDF, etc.);
  • Make your software analyst cover letter personal by mentioning the recruiters' first or last name;
  • Within the introduction, describe what you like best about the company in no more than two sentences;
  • Use your software analyst cover letter body to tell a story of your greatest achievement, backed up by job-relevant skills and technologies;
  • If you have no professional experience, be honest about it in your software analyst cover letter, but also write about your unique talents.
Rate my article:
Professional Software Analyst Cover Letter Examples for 2024
Average: 4.80 / 5.00
(564 people already rated it)
Volen Vulkov
Volen Vulkov is a resume expert and the co-founder of Enhancv. He applies his deep knowledge and experience to write about a career change, development, and how to stand out in the job application process.
AI Section BackgroundAI Section Lines

AI cover letter writer, powered by ChatGPT

Enhancv harnesses the capabilities of ChatGPT to provide a streamlined interface designed specifically focused on composing a compelling cover letter without the hassle of thinking about formatting and wording.

  • Content tailored to the job posting you're applying for
  • ChatGPT model specifically trained by Enhancv
  • Lightning-fast responses
Create a Cover Letter
Cover Letter Background
Cover Letter Example
AI Panel Box